Known for his infectious smile and clear, versatile texture, Udit Narayan was the definitive voice for superstars like Aamir Khan and Shah Rukh Khan. His rendition of romantic and playful tracks remains unmatched. Hits Of The 90s Hindi Songs

The permanence of 90s Hindi music relies heavily on its lyrical depth and organic instrumentation. Lyricists like Anand Bakshi, Javed Akhtar, and Sameer wrote words that were poetic yet simple enough for the common man to sing along to. Unlike the electronic loops prevalent today, 90s music heavily relied on live orchestras, violins, tablas, and flutes, giving the songs a warm, textured acoustic feel.
The focus was on creating melodies that were hummable and easy to remember.
